  1. Pathogenesis, presentation, and treatment of keratoconus within the United States

    Keratoconus is a non-inflammatory thinning of the cornea that can lead to an irregular conical shaped protrusion generally of the lower mid-peripheral nasal or temporal hemisphere of the cornea.
